Structure and Content of the Theory Exam
The Swedish driving theory test includes 65 concerns, from which 60 are scored and 5 are speculative concerns utilized for future test development. Candidates need to achieve a minimum score of 52 right answers out of the 60 scored concerns to pass, which corresponds to approximately 87% accuracy. The examination covers numerous classifications of knowledge, each screening various elements of accountable driving.
The question formats vary between multiple-choice and direct reaction concerns, with some items requiring prospects to determine aspects within traffic images or situations. The visual elements present prospects with photos or videos depicting different traffic scenarios, requiring them to determine correct actions, potential risks, or guideline offenses. This multimedia approach guarantees that theoretical knowledge translates to real-world recognition and proper reactions.
| Test Component | Details |
|---|---|
| Total Questions | 65 (60 scored, 5 experimental) |
| Passing Threshold | 52 right out of 60 scored |
| Question Types | Multiple-choice, direct action, visual recognition |
| Exam Duration | Roughly 50 minutes |
| Readily available Languages | Swedish and 14 other languages |
| Fee | Approximately 325 SEK |

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them
Numerous candidates battle with the risk understanding components, which need fast and precise evaluation of establishing hazardous situations. The secret to improvement depends on substantial practice with varied scenarios, training the eye to acknowledge subtle cues that indicate prospective problems. Understanding that dangers can develop from multiple sources-- other vehicles, pedestrians, road conditions, and weather condition-- assists prospects establish more thorough threat awareness.
Language barriers present difficulties for some prospects, particularly new citizens who may be not familiar with driving terminology in Swedish. Thankfully, the theory exam is offered in fifteen different languages, allowing candidates to finish the assessment in their native tongue. Nevertheless, prospects must think about that practical driving direction occurs mostly in Swedish, so some familiarity with driving-related vocabulary proves useful for the subsequent practical training.
The speculative concerns consisted of in each examination can unsettle some candidates who come across unknown content. Understanding that these questions do not impact scoring helps candidates preserve composure when dealing with novel products. Staying focused on showing understanding through familiar concerns avoids stress and anxiety about experimental items from undermining overall performance.
The Path to Practical Driving
Passing the theory exam represents a significant milestone but not the last location in getting a Swedish chauffeur's license. The theory certificate stays valid for two years, throughout which prospects should finish their needed practical training and roadway test. This validity period motivates candidates to advance effectively through the remaining licensing requirements while guaranteeing their theoretical understanding stays present.
The useful driving test evaluates Candidates' ability to use their theoretical understanding in genuine traffic conditions. Inspectors evaluate not just technical lorry control but likewise decision-making, anticipation of dangers, and adherence to the safety concepts studied in the theory portion. Prospects who truly internalized their theoretical training typically demonstrate more positive and proper responses throughout the useful assessment.

Can I take the theory examination in English or my native language?
Yes, the Swedish driving theory examination is offered in Swedish plus fourteen other languages, including English, Arabic, Persian, Somali, and numerous European languages. Nevertheless, candidates should keep in mind that the practical driving lessons and road test are performed in Swedish, so establishing some Swedish vocabulary associated to driving proves helpful.

Do I require to finish the theory exam before starting useful driving lessons?
Swedish guidelines require prospects to pass the theory test before booking their useful driving test, however prospects might begin useful training before passing the theory examination. Numerous driving schools motivate candidates to study theory concurrently with practical lessons, as the experiential learning from behind-the-wheel practice can reinforce theoretical understanding.
